In Edgar Allan Poe's "The Tell-Tale Heart," the narrator's obsession with the old man's eye ultimately leads him to commit murder. He insists he is not mad, but rather hyper-aware of his own senses. The sound of the old man's heartbeat torments the narrator, pushing him to confess to his crime. The story's use of first-person point of view allows the reader to enter the mind of the narrator and experience his descent into madness. Poe's vivid descriptions of the setting, such as the darkness of the room and the intense focus on the old man's eye, create a tense and eerie atmosphere that lingers throughout the story. Overall, "The Tell-Tale Heart" is a chilling exploration of the human mind and the lengths to which obsession and fear can drive a person.
